Patricia J BAYBECK

[N12057]

12 MAR 1939 - 24 NOV 2014

  • BIRTH: 12 MAR 1939, Saginaw, Michigan
  • DEATH: 24 NOV 2014, South Bend, IN
Father: Walter BAYBECK
Mother: Josephine ACHTABOWSKI

Family 1 : James L. DAVIS
  • MARRIAGE: 19 JUL 1958, Saginaw, Michigan, USA

[N12057] Patricia J. Davis
Mar. 12, 1939 - Nov. 24, 2014

SOUTH BEND - Patricia J. Davis, 75, passed away at home on Monday, November 24, 2014. Patricia was born on March 12, 1939 in Saginaw, MI to Walter and Josephine (Achtabowski) Baybeck. She was preceded in death by her parents; a son, Allen Davis and a brother, Patrick Baybeck. On July 19, 1958 in Saginaw, MI, Patricia married James L. Davis. Surviving are her loving husband, James; daughters, Julie (Claude) Taylor of Granger, Jill (Gerald) Keyes of Zionsville, IN and Joy (Mike) Overstreet of Mankato, MN; seven grandchildren, Kelsey and Megan Davis, Aaron and Adam Keyes, James Overstreet and Halie and Hanah Taylor; sisters, Mary (Roger) D'Hondt of Rochester Hills, MI, Judy (Richard) Henning of Saginaw, MI and brothers, Pete (Linda) Baybeck of Arlington, TN and Michael (Edith) Baybeck of Bridgeport, MI. Also surviving is a daughter-in-law, Sheri Davis of Fort Wayne, IN and many nieces and nephews. Patricia enjoyed spending her free time reading; she read almost every book in the library, she was a great cook, an avid bowler and enjoyed her trip to Las Vegas with her daughters. She was a valued employee at Tuesday Morning and worked many years at Target. She belonged to bowling leagues, Bunko Club and Bercliff Garden Club. She treasured her time with her family and grandchildren, and the fun times spent with her sisters and her mom on many trips. She was a special NANA- she never missed choir concerts, soccer games, lacrosse games or any of her grandchildren's sporting events.
